The Aviation Center at Middletown Regional Airport is a transformative investment made possible through strong public and private partnerships, bringing together Butler Tech, local aviation leaders, and regional stakeholders to expand access to aviation education. Opened in 2026, the purpose-built hangar facility houses Butler Tech’s Aviation: 3-Year Program, delivering immersive, hands-on training in aircraft maintenance, aviation technology, and career pathways across the aviation industry. The expanded program begins in students’ sophomore year, allowing them to spend three years building technical expertise, earning industry-recognized credentials, and engaging in authentic work-based learning experiences inside an active airport environment. Designed to meet the growing demand for aviation professionals across the region and beyond, the Aviation Center strengthens the workforce pipeline and prepares learners with the skills, experience, and confidence to launch high-wage, high-demand careers in aviation.
